Description Paul Robinson 2005-05-02 18:51:26 UTC
In some cases, even though I have not logged out nor changed IP addresses, an
attempt to log in with my e-mail address and my password brings up the red
banner indicating it's wrong, and yet logging in from a different browser window
with the same information does work, but attempting to log in again with the
exact same information in the other window (whose status shows I'm not logged
in) fails.  It keeps telling me the username or password is incorrect, and still
seems to think I am not logged in in that window and won't let me log in.

Comment 2 lɛʁi לערי ריינהארט 2006-04-27 22:41:47 UTC
Hallo!

This can happen if cookies are not enabeled. Please note that cookies can be
blocked /enabeled by third party software, in each browser, per domain, subdomain.

I just checked the behaviour from the initial comment with denying cookies to
http://bugzilla.wikipedia.org/show_bug.cgi?id=2052 wikipedia (with "p").

After "logging in" all seems fine; if you click on "preferences", "my bugs", "my
votes" you are logged out. I could not see any textual hint about enableing
cookies. This is a problem if cookies have been denied in the past and this was
"remembered".

best regards reinhardt [[user:gangleri]]
Comment 3 Brion Vibber 2006-04-27 22:46:05 UTC
Cookies are required.
